How do I understand when my pipes have ruptured?
Rising and fall water stress
Pipes do not just burst in a day. You may have discovered that your kitchen tap or shower doesn't run instantly when you turn the faucet. It may pause for a few secs and then blast you with more force than typical.
In other instances, the water may seem typical initially, after that decrease in stress after a couple of secs.
Infected water
Many individuals think a ruptured pipeline is a one-way electrical outlet. Fairly the contrary. As water spurts of the hole or gash in your plumbing system, pollutants find their way in.
Your water may be polluted from the source, so if you can, inspect if your water storage tank has any type of troubles. Nonetheless, if your alcohol consumption water is provided and also detoxified by the local government, you need to call your plumber immediately if you see or smell anything funny in your water.
Puddles under pipes and sinks
When a pipe bursts, the outflow forms a puddle. It may appear that the puddle is growing in dimension, and also despite the amount of times you mop the puddle, in a few minutes, there's another one waiting to be cleaned. Frequently, you may not be able to trace the pool to any kind of noticeable pipelines. This is an indicator to call a specialist plumber.
Damp wall surfaces as well as water spots
Before a pipe ruptureds, it will certainly leak, many times. If this persistent leaking goes unnoticed, the leak may graduate right into a vast tear in your pipeline. One simple method to avoid this emergency is to look out for damp wall surfaces ad water stains. These water stains will certainly lead you right to the leakage.
Untraceable leaking noises
Pipe ruptureds can take place in the most undesirable areas, like within concrete, inside wall surfaces, or under sinks. When your home goes silent, you might have the ability to listen to an irritatingly persistent dripping sound. Even after you've examined your shower head and also kitchen area tap, the trickling might continue.
Dear viewers, the leaking may be originating from a pipe inside your walls. There isn't much you can do concerning that, except inform an expert plumber.

First, let’s talk about frozen pipes. Every winter, our experts here at JD Service Now, Heating, and Air Conditioning are called in on frozen pipe jobs that need immediate service. Frozen pipes happen because pipes are exposed or hose bibbs aren’t properly winterized. We’re also seen some instances where homeowners forgot to clear out and shut off their sprinkler systems at the end of the summer the result is not pretty! When water is left standing in a pipeline over the course of the hard North Carolina winter, it freezes and expands. If it expands too quickly before the homeowner realizes there’s a problem, it can burst the pipe and require emergency plumbing pipe repair.
But frozen pipes can be avoided! Just follow these three tips to winterize your home and keep your plumbing safe:
Get an Insulation Blanket for the Hot Water Heater
Having a water heater leak can make a serious mess: if you don’t have an automatic shut-off valve on the device, the storage tank will continue trying to fill itself. Avoid disaster this winter by taking extra precautions. You can buy an insulating blanket for your hot water tank at your local hardware store for less than $50, and the investment could save you hundreds in water damage repairs!
Shut Down Sprinkler Systems
Before we transition into the bitter cold of winter, do this simple check: have you winterized your sprinkler system? You probably haven’t thought about watering your lawn since the summer ended, but it’s still important to put some time into completely closing the water supply valve and then clearing out the water from the pipes. This involves blowing compressed air through the sprinkler lines to ensure there’s no standing water left to freeze.
Heat-Taping on Exposed Pipes
An easy way to prevent frozen pipes is heat taping, which you can do on your own. Electrical heating tape is cheap, and if you insulate your exposed pipes with it before the temperature drops, you can greatly decrease your risk.
